Arab countries should support US on China, Waller says

Arab countries have a self-interest in supporting the United States on China, Center Senior Analyst for Strategy J Michael Waller tells Alhurra Arabic TV.
Energy-producing Arab Gulf states depend on a strong American presence in the region to deter the Iranian regime and others, Waller said, explaining that the US Navy’s aircraft carrier battlegroup presence in the region not only secures the sealanes, but protects Arab countries from Iranian aggression.
If Communist China’s aggressive actions force the US to increase its naval presence in the Indo-Pacific region, it would be to Arab countries’ detriment and Iran’s benefit, Waller said. Any such diversion of American seapower from the Middle East to China would benefit Iran.

Alhurra is the Arabic-language TV network run by the US government for public diplomacy and strategic communication purposes. It has a strong following among Arabic-speaking audiences.
